
LocalTube is an enhanced, self-hosted streaming server solution built on top of a specialized fork of NewPipe Extractor. By bundling a lightweight and concurrent Java HTTP server inside an Android application, LocalTube enables you to browse, search, and stream content from major streaming platforms directly from any device in your local network using a standard web browser.
Key Features:
- Decentralized Local Server: Runs a lightweight, concurrent Java HTTP server directly on your Android device (default port 8080), serving a modern, responsive web interface.
- Cross-Device Playback: Connect seamlessly to the server from any device on your local network (PC, laptop, smart TV, tablet) by visiting your device's local IP.
- Theme Customization: Toggle between modern Dark and clean Light themes instantly.
- Private Watch History: Tracks your watched videos locally on the host device using a secure SQLite database, maintaining privacy with zero external telemetry or tracking.
- HTML5 Player & Stream Proxying: Proxies stream traffic through the local server to bypass client-side signature and throttling restrictions, fully supporting seeking and fast-forwarding within native browser elements.
WhatsNew:
Made console logs scrollable and colorful
Updated NewPipeExtractor to v0.26.3
Anti-Features: NonFreeNet (this application promotes/depends a non-Free network service):
⇒ Connects to YouTube, SoundCloud, PeerTube and Bandcamp.